Output eeca2821578ca9b4357951c4414f2d3cd19c565e434d7d0f3f85650e9f76a96c:19

value
3200000
script pubkey
OP_0 OP_PUSHBYTES_20 697657bc9b36f4a15cfb225d7a7ea9c18d5035c9
address
bc1qd9m900ymxm62zh8myfwh5l4fcxx4qdwfp4xetc
transaction
eeca2821578ca9b4357951c4414f2d3cd19c565e434d7d0f3f85650e9f76a96c
confirmations
16813
spent
true